在mysql中,時間字段是很常用的一種數據類型。時間字段表示一個具體的時間點,它能夠幫助我們更方便地記錄一些具有時間屬性的數據。
當我們在定義時間字段時,有時候需要給它一個默認值。這時,我們可能會想到使用時間字段的最小值來作為它的默認值。
那么,mysql中時間字段的最小值是多少呢?
1970-01-01 00:00:01
是的,mysql中時間字段的最小值就是上述的值,也被稱為“基準時間點”或者“Epoch時間點”。
那么,為什么是這個時間點呢?這是因為1970年1月1日0時0分0秒被定為了UNIX操作系統的起始時間,所有的計算機都將這個時間點作為它們內部的時間起點。因此,1970-01-01 00:00:01就是時間字段的最小值了。
需要注意的是,這個最小值只適用于DATETIME類型的時間字段,TIMESTAMP類型的時間字段的最小值是1970-01-01 00:00:00。
總之,了解mysql中時間字段的最小值,可以幫助我們更好地使用這種數據類型,避免出現一些奇怪的問題。